Can you grow Houseplants in an Oasesbox?

The answer to that question is yes. Different houseplants will be suited to self-watering planters better than others, such as Calathea. We do not recommend planting cacti in a self-watering planter as they prefer a drier environment. Calathea can grow and thrive in a self-watering planter, such as Oasesbox.
